Transaction 3cb6c287756fac0a96c30c3b403e96afbdfe5661c5818320d8e1a88f12bc8f14
1 Input
1 Output
-
3cb6c287756fac0a96c30c3b403e96afbdfe5661c5818320d8e1a88f12bc8f14:0
- value
- 2177804
- script pubkey
- OP_0 OP_PUSHBYTES_20 807bac0d8b23ec1338646e614ad66768aa56d430
- address
- bc1qspa6crvty0kpxwrydes544n8dz49d4pscpv7p7